Evolution, an international solo online painting exhibition by Robert Bohle, opens on June 01, and will continue until June 30, 2023.

Robert Bohle work is focused on abstract style as it gives him an opportunity to communicate with viewer in a personal level, an introvert artist with loud and extravert paintings. It is notable that Robert has suffered with Parkinson’s disease for the past 22 years and the jagged edges that appear in many of his paintings represent how he feels about the interface now between the universe and him.

Robert Bohle is mainly a painter of abstracts, sometimes completely non-representational and sometimes not. He began painting in 2015 after he retired from a 43-year career as a teacher, college professor and design and typography consultant to newspapers. His work has been selected for multiple juried shows.
